Gold Nanoparticles Make More Flexible Electronics
|
|
|
By embedding tiny pieces of gold in polyurethane, researchers have developed a stretchable, flexible conductor that could bring us a step closer to truly “foldable” devices.
|
The technology, created by a team from the University of Michigan, involves depositing layers of gold particles between layers of polyurethane. Rather than moving further apart when the polymer was stretched, the tiny gold particles arranged themselves into chains, allowing the material to remain conductive even when stretched to almost six times its original length.
